Pokemon Masters EX Announce New Event for the Remainder of May

Pokemon Masters EX has a new event set to release on May 16 that will run all the way until the end of the month, May 27. The event, entitled ‘Special Event Phase 2: Land and Sea Awaken’, is a continuation of the current ‘Event Phase 1: Weather Alert’ which has had players investigating strange rain and drought patterns throughout the artificial Pokemon paradise of Pasio.

Pokemon Masters EX Event Phase 2

It turns out these strange changes in climate may have something to do with a certain pair of weather-changing legendary Pokemon (cough, cough, Kyogre, and Groudon) and players will be tasked with battling them using weather survey tickets. DeNA Co., the developers of the mobile game, mention that the “collective decisions of the player community will dictate the number of rewards that will be distributed” in this phase.

Consistent Pokemon Masters EX players will likely already have a collection of these tickets built up as they have been available since the start of the first phase on May 5, but those who don’t can start earning them by completing their one daily battle in the event arena. Players who log into the game during this new phase will also be eligible for a Team Magma or Team Aqua badge (depending on which corresponding legendary Pokemon is defeated more times) as well as the following bonus rewards:

  • Players who complete battles in this event will earn rewards that can be exchanged for items like 5★ Power-Ups and co-op sync orbs.
  • A bonus reward of Gems, 5★ Power-Ups, and Move Candies will be distributed at a later date, with the amount of rewards dependent on the total number of battles that the player community completes during this event.

Pokemon Masters EX Splash and Punch

There are also new sync pairs from Pokemon: Sword and Shield being added in this update, with Nessa & Drednaw and Bea & Sirfetch’d making an appearance to accompany some of the previously added Sword and Shield favorites, Gloria and Zacian. Finally, the ‘Splash and Punch’ solo event has also been introduced until May 28, pitting Galar gym leaders Nessa and Bea against former gym leaders Misty and Maylene. This event will also feature player rewards and daily log-in bonuses which can be viewed here.
